A special team of tour guides for the Foothills Fall Festival is being established in memory of a dedicated volunteer.

Sharon Zesut, a Maryville real estate broker, died in April at age 60.

"She was a dedicated volunteer for the festival, and her enthusiasm and smile will be missed," said Jane Groff, festival events coordinator.

A group of Zesut's real estate associates have established the Z-Team to work at the festival Oct. 10-12 in her honor. Z-Team members will be tour guides for folks riding the bus to the festival from Foothills Mall.

Team members, wearing a vest and company name badge, will provide information about the festival and the area to festival-goers. They will also obtain information from visitors to help festival coordinators in planning.

Volunteers get a free ticket to the festival, food and drink for the day and can purchase two more tickets at a reduced rate.

Membership is being offered to all real estate agents and staff in Blount County.

Jackie North, of Century 21 Real Estate Group, is Z-Team coordinator. For more information, call the festival office at 273-3445.
